When you order a package on Amazon, Last Mile Operations is in charge of the final delivery to your home. Central Operations' mandate is to centralize all tasks that can be centralized across Japan's 200+ last mile node network. Thanks to CO, tasks can be standardized, optimized and automated, resulting in better delivery experience for customers, at a lower cost. Strategically, the team allows JP Ops to grow by double digits every year, without increasing complexity and cost at the same rate. Central Operations is the nerve center of Amazon's last-mile delivery network in Japan. We plan and execute the daily movement of millions of packages across hundreds of facilities — managing capacity, resolving disruptions in real time, and ensuring customers receive their deliveries on time. Sitting at the intersection of operations, analytics and technology, the team translates long-term network strategy into daily operational decisions. As the network scales rapidly in complexity and volume, we drive automation, build scalable mechanisms, and develop the analytical capabilities needed to operate one of the fastest-growing logistics networks in the world.
